ternary complex of L277A, H511A, R514 mutant pol lambda bound to a 2 nucleotide gapped DNA substrate with a scrunched dA

About this Structure

3hx0 is a 16 chain structure of DNA polymerase with sequence from Homo sapiens. Full crystallographic information is available from OCA.
